Driving directions from Thornton le Fen, United Kingdom to Devoke Water, United Kingdom distance


Thornton le Fen, United Kingdom
Devoke Water, United Kingdom
Thornton le Fen to Devoke Water road map

Thornton le Fen to Devoke Water flight distance miles / km

159.0 mi / 255.9 km